首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何自定义SQL查询结果(select中的select)

自定义SQL查询结果是通过在SELECT语句中嵌套一个子查询来实现的。子查询可以作为SELECT语句中的一个列,返回一个结果集作为查询的一部分。

在自定义SQL查询结果中,可以使用子查询来获取额外的信息或计算结果,以满足特定的查询需求。子查询可以嵌套多层,每一层都可以根据需要进行进一步的筛选和计算。

下面是一个示例,演示如何使用自定义SQL查询结果:

代码语言:txt
复制
SELECT column1, column2, (SELECT COUNT(*) FROM table2 WHERE condition) AS custom_column
FROM table1
WHERE condition;

在上面的示例中,我们使用了一个子查询来计算满足特定条件的table2表中的行数,并将其作为一个自定义列custom_column返回。同时,我们还选择了table1表中的column1和column2列。

自定义SQL查询结果的应用场景包括但不限于:

  1. 统计查询:通过子查询获取满足特定条件的行数、求和、平均值等统计信息。
  2. 嵌套查询:在查询结果中嵌套子查询,以获取更详细或更精确的信息。
  3. 条件查询:根据子查询的结果进行条件判断,实现复杂的查询逻辑。
  4. 数据转换:通过子查询将数据进行转换或格式化,以满足特定的需求。

腾讯云提供了多个与数据库相关的产品,可以帮助您进行自定义SQL查询结果的实现和优化。以下是一些相关产品和其介绍链接:

  1. 云数据库 TencentDB:提供高性能、可扩展的云数据库服务,支持多种数据库引擎,包括MySQL、SQL Server、PostgreSQL等。链接:https://cloud.tencent.com/product/cdb
  2. 云数据库 Redis:提供高性能、可靠的内存数据库服务,支持多种数据结构和复杂查询操作。链接:https://cloud.tencent.com/product/cmem
  3. 云数据库 MongoDB:提供高性能、可扩展的NoSQL数据库服务,适用于大规模数据存储和复杂查询需求。链接:https://cloud.tencent.com/product/cosmosdb
  4. 数据库审计 TencentDB Audit:提供数据库审计服务,记录和分析数据库操作,帮助保护数据安全和合规性。链接:https://cloud.tencent.com/product/dbaudit

请注意,以上产品仅为示例,您可以根据具体需求选择适合的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券